About the event

Sustainability LIVE @ London Climate Action Week - The Leadership Summit is a one-day conference targeting senior sustainability executives working on climate action strategy.

With more than 250 people planning to attend in person, the conference programme will include 25 expert speakers and four interactive executive workshops.

The programme offers practical guidance and strategic perspective on embedding climate action across operations, supply chains and investment decisions. 

Learning outcomes

The panel discussion will take place in The Enterprise Theatre from 14:15 to 15:00 (BST) where speakers will discuss practical applications of AI in sustainability contexts.

Topics include emissions tracking, predictive climate modelling and optimising energy systems. Supply chain transparency will also feature in the discussion.

Panel members will address opportunities, risks and ethical considerations, examining how AI functions as a tool for accountability in sustainability outcomes.

The broader conference aims to help leaders navigate what organisers describe as a rapidly evolving sustainability landscape shaped by shifting regulation, innovation and global policy.

Meet the speakers 

Sophie Graham, Chief Sustainability Officer, IFS

Sophie Graham, Chief Sustainability Officer at IFS, oversees the delivery of IFS' sustainability strategy throughout its operations.

She will speak on The Future of AI in Sustainability Panel, sharing her expertise from her role at IFS.  

With a background in environmental law, Sophie has worked across EMEA, the Americas and the UK in the technology and finance sectors 

Sophie Graham, Chief Sustainability Officer at IFS

She says: “With IFS, we work with heavy industries, so there are some real sustainability benefits on an industrial scale that can be realised through applying AI to business optimisation, resource allocation and capital allocation decisions.”

Salah Said, Director of Sustainability, Klarna

Salah has over a decade of experience in sustainability, social innovation and corporate responsibility. 

He previously worked in nonprofits, social entrepreneurship and major European corporations.

Salah says: “I've been in sustainability for more than 12 years now. Before that, I was working a lot in nonprofits, social innovation, social businesses and entrepreneurship and I felt it was always so hard to get corporates to do more.

“I felt there was a need to change things from within. So, sustainability was a great opportunity for me to go and do a little bit of entrepreneurship and help companies do better.”

Salah Said, Director of Sustainability at Klarna
